4. Soylent Red, Green And Yellow - Soylent Green(1973)
Soylent Green is a gritty and claustrophobic take on a futuristic America. Charlton Heston stars as a detective wandering through New York City, now bursting at the seams with a population of over 40 million impoverished and ravenous people. The only choices of food stuff is an oddly luminescent jelly that comes in the three flavours of red, green and yellow.If youve heard anything about this film, you probably know the denouement at the end (if not, youre in for a delightfully ugly twist). No matter how many times you return to the film, when the camera pans into Hestons face and the grim realisation floods over his wide eyes, theres still a shuddering chill that travels down your spine and into your stomach.
